Very Easy to setup and pack away, however the straps it comes with to secure it wouldn’t ever be long enough… I had to add my maxtrax straps to each side to make them long enough to tie back to the roof rack. The T nuts provided didn’t suit my rhino rack vortex roof bars but may suit others. I did have an issue with the lock nuts not wanting to be undone and breaking a bolt, after that I decided it was best to use aftermarket nut and bolt accessories with spring washers to prevent that happening again. Brackets provided are very solid can be mounted both ways. Happy with the quality of the awning material it’s very water proof, water just slides off it. The USB cord for the lights has plenty of length so think it would suit most people’s use cases. Plugs into USB A port.

* This is an initial review * Pros: - Sturdy construction and still strong enough if you are only using 2 brackets but would highly suggest being more cautious if wind becomes a thing when camping. - You get good quality for the price you pay - Has a little stand thingy to help rain drain off the roof - Has tie down at the middle of every part of the awning so water will not pool - Included lighting and wiring which is a big plus so it means I don't need to mount lighting - Built in main 2 front legs so if you need to tie down it's super quick and more importantly easy. - The zipper bag that protects the awning when not in used is oversized so makes packing up an absolute breeze. - Straps that hold the awning when packed up are girthy and seem heavy duty Cons: - I wish the hardware that was included worked with Rhino Racks and found this surprising as I have never come across this issue with other awnings or anything mounted to my racks. The problem was the base were not long enough so when you went to tighten them nothing was happening. Had to buy my own to make it work. - This one probably the biggest oversight, the included straps so you can taught the awning are wayyyy to short with what the manual was wanting you to do and will end up buying my own. - This is just me and my expectation but some bolts were a smidge loose (glad you guys have a warning label right in front of you) I understand shipping and what not could possibly cause bolts to come loose but wasn't expecting it. - The small bars that were holding the straps were crooked - Mine actually arrived damaged, not to the point of not being able to use it but was surprised especially with how well packed it was and the box was undamaged so seems like someone just didn't see it. I know this company is fairly new to the AUS market but I really hope in future QC stuff gets a little more comprehensive and something I am definitely hoping to see in future is different hardware and longer straps. I will be totally honest I paid $650 for the awning so having the odd hiccup of not good hardware is ok and I wasn't expecting a lot from the awning even though it is pretty good for what you pay but if I had paid the original price of $1100 I would have been super upset with the purchase. We've been looking at a variety of 270 awnings and decided on the 270+ Openroad . It comes with absolutely everything you need to set it up and secure it . 6 poles (4 fitted 2 in a bag ) . Guy ropes and tent pegs . Best of all are the 4 built in 3 stage lights with an attached bag to put your powerpack . Easy to set up and pack away too . A couple of attachments on the awning arms to help with water drainage is a practical touch as well . A perfect package for us at a brilliant price for such a quality product . Mounted the 180 degrees awning on Thule Wingbar Evo on the roof of Ranger. Stretched the crossbars as far as I can. Mounting is very easy with 2 person doing it. Very steady and stable. Good quality frame and canvas. Easy to open and close. Only complaint is that website states the length of the awning as 190cm but it is really 210+ cm. This is important to me as I want minimum overhang since I am mounting it on the roof of a dual cab on crossbars. Anyway, it turned out ok. Thrilled with the end results.
